The Blood Bank Management Software Market encompasses specialized digital platforms designed to streamline and optimize the operations of blood banks and transfusion services. These software solutions facilitate donor management, inventory control, blood testing, tracking, and compliance with regulatory standards. By integrating real-time data analytics, automated reporting, and secure data storage, these systems enhance operational efficiency, reduce errors, and improve patient safety. As healthcare providers increasingly prioritize digital transformation, the market for such software is experiencing rapid growth, driven by the demand for industry-specific innovations that meet stringent quality and safety standards.

Despite robust growth prospects, the blood bank management software market faces several challenges. High implementation costs and ongoing maintenance expenses can hinder adoption, especially among smaller blood banks and in developing regions. The complexity of integrating new software with existing legacy systems may cause operational disruptions. Data privacy concerns and stringent regulatory requirements necessitate continuous compliance efforts, adding to operational burdens. Limited awareness and technical expertise in some regions can impede market penetration. Furthermore, concerns over vendor lock-in and data migration issues pose additional barriers to widespread adoption.
